首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用外键序列化关联2表

外键序列化关联两个表是一种数据库设计和数据管理的方法。在关系型数据库中,表与表之间可以通过外键建立关联关系,以实现数据的一致性和完整性。而外键序列化关联则是将外键的值序列化存储在一个表中,以减少表之间的关联查询。

外键序列化关联的主要步骤如下:

  1. 创建两个表,分别为主表和从表。主表包含主键字段,从表包含外键字段。
  2. 在主表中插入数据,并获取主键值。
  3. 将主键值序列化存储在从表的外键字段中。
  4. 当需要查询两个表的关联数据时,先从从表中获取外键值,然后再根据外键值查询主表获取相关数据。

外键序列化关联的优势包括:

  1. 减少关联查询的次数,提高查询效率。由于外键值已经序列化存储在从表中,可以直接通过外键值查询主表,而无需进行关联查询。
  2. 简化数据管理。外键序列化关联可以减少表之间的关联关系,简化数据管理和维护的复杂性。
  3. 提高数据的一致性和完整性。通过外键序列化关联,可以确保从表中的外键值与主表中的主键值一致,保证数据的一致性和完整性。

外键序列化关联适用于以下场景:

  1. 当两个表之间的关联查询频繁,并且数据量较大时,可以采用外键序列化关联来提高查询效率。
  2. 当数据管理和维护的复杂性较高时,可以采用外键序列化关联来简化数据管理。
  3. 当需要保证数据的一致性和完整性时,可以采用外键序列化关联来确保数据的一致性和完整性。

腾讯云提供了多个与数据库相关的产品,其中包括云数据库 TencentDB,可以满足外键序列化关联的需求。具体产品介绍和链接地址如下:

  • 云数据库 TencentDB:提供了多种数据库引擎,包括 MySQL、SQL Server、PostgreSQL 等,支持外键关联和序列化存储。详细信息请参考腾讯云数据库 TencentDB

请注意,以上答案仅供参考,具体的数据库设计和选择产品的决策应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

42分1秒

尚硅谷-71-外键约束的使用

28分16秒

14. 尚硅谷_佟刚_Hibernate_基于外键映射的1-1关联关系

18分11秒

11.尚硅谷-IDEA-常用的快捷键的使用2.avi

18分11秒

11.尚硅谷-IDEA-常用的快捷键的使用2.avi

14分38秒

102-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O说明

4分51秒

103-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O编码步骤

17分43秒

106-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O编码 测试准备

9分52秒

107-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O编码 测试完成

22分31秒

104-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O编码 初始化函数

23分57秒

105-尚硅谷-Flink实时数仓-DWM层-订单宽表 关联维度 优化2 异步IO编码 异步函数完成

13分7秒

尚硅谷基于腾讯云EMR搭建实时数据仓库(2023版)/视频/097-腾讯云EMR-实时数仓搭建-DWS层-交易域-SKU粒度下单需求-关联维表-异步IO-异步函数 2.mp4

4分8秒

47_ClickHouse高级_多表关联_大小表JOIN

领券